BMW was founded in 1916 and just recently celebrated its 100th anniversary. The logo for BMW is distinctive and easily recognizable.BMW is an abbreviation for Bayerische Motoren Werke GmbH, which literally means “Bavarian Motor Works” in English. The company’s roots are in Bavaria, Germany, hence the name. It also refers to BMW’s original product line, which consisted of a wide variety of engines.

What is BMW strategy Number One?

Strategy Number ONE. In autumn 2007, BMW Group adopted the Strategy Number ONE with its four pillars: “Growth”, “Shaping the future”, “Profitability” and “Access to technology and customers”. It aligns the BMW Group with two targets: to be profitable and to enhance long-term value in times of change.
